The Chiefs’ Highway to Victory: Cease the Tush Push

One of the crucial controversial—and aptly named—performs in current soccer historical past is the Tush Push. It’s a transfer perfected by the Eagles after a 2022 rule change that allowed groups to push a participant ahead in a rugby-style scrum to realize quick yardage. Though many soccer insiders and followers have petitioned that the Tush Push return to the realm of unlawful formations, it’s at present legit.

The Eagles have had unparalleled success with this transfer, partially due to the absurd energy of their quarterback, Jalen Hurts. Within the NFC Championship recreation that propelled the Eagles to Tremendous Bowl 2025, Hurts scored two touchdowns on Tush Pushes.

So how do you thwart it?

“The Tush Push is a really dynamic transfer that requires a whole lot of ahead momentum to start out and cease,” explains Aidala. If the Chiefs’ protection is to carry the road, they’ll want immense energy and suppleness within the glutes, hamstrings, and calves shut this down.

A man in blue shorts and a top practices Downward-Facing Dog with his knees bent. He is on a wood-plank floor with a white wall behind him
The form of Down Canine successfully stretches the complete again physique, from the pinnacle to the heels. (Photograph: Andrew Clark)

Aidala suggests Downward Canine to assist construct flexibility within the decrease physique. Leverage is essential. Downward Canine helps construct energy so you may push out of your hips and glutes. He notes it additionally stretches the calves, which “additionally come into play as you push again in opposition to the human sled of the offense.”

“For resisting the type of push the line of defense will face, I might be spending time in Malasana [Squat or Garland Pose],” says Kittle. To maximise the hip stretch, it’s important to decrease the physique so the hips drop beneath the knees, he notes, after which both settle into the stretch or repeat units of squats to construct energy. Equally, Goddess Pose features as a complementary form to a Squat that equally challenges the hips, quads, and calves, explains Kittle.

The Eagles’ Highway to Victory: Discover Defensive Agility

A soccer dynasty, the Chiefs have taken house three Tremendous Bowl championships within the early 2020s due to wunderkind quarterback Patrick Mahomes and the death-by-a-thousand cuts offensive method that retains the opposing crew’s protection guessing who will make the subsequent large play. Witness the Chiefs’ 32-29 AFC Championship victory, by which star tight finish Travis Kelce caught solely two passes whereas rookie Xavier Worthy led the crew in receptions and scored a landing.

This type of unpredictability as to who may have palms on the ball requires a protection that may swap instructions on a dime.

Aidala recommends gamers prepare with a dynamic Facet Lunge (aka Flying Monkey), transitioning from one aspect to the opposite to construct fast-twitch energy within the hips. Additionally, Aidala explains that the stronger your core, the simpler it’s to maneuver rapidly and sustain with the offense. For that, he recommends Forearm Plank.

And to work on response time, Kittle suggests the Eagles follow holding and transitioning in between the Warrior poses (Warrior 1, Warrior 2, Reverse Warrior, and Warrior 3). “Whereas yoga, typically, is just not usually inclusive of rapid-fire actions, the Warrior collection works all the muscle teams and could be very difficult. The flexibleness and energy this builds can be useful for quickness and pace,” he says.

Each Chiefs and Eagles: Maintain Onto the Ball

All through the playoffs this yr, the crew that has turned the ball over fewer instances has gone 11-1. Defending the ball from defenders attempting to dislodge it requires staying sturdy within the core and arms. Yoga will help.

Plank Pose
Shifting from Plank to Down Canine to One-Legged Canine and again into Plank calls for the physique consciousness, energy, and focus required to carry onto that soccer it doesn’t matter what. (Photograph: Andrew Clark)

“Ball safety is a matter of fixed focus and have to be practiced every day time and again, very similar to yoga,” says Kittle. “So partaking in a slower follow, holding poses for 3 to 5 breaths, and actually concentrating on the pose and being in contact together with your physique by motion and breath will assist.”

He suggests shifting from Plank Pose to Downward Canine to One-Legged Downward Canine with some low push-ups blended in: “Every of those works the arms, chest, shoulders, and core, constructing energy and consciousness within the core muscle teams which might be required for top-level ball safety.”

Additionally falling beneath the theme of sudden coaching to carry onto the ball, Aidala suggests spending time in Half Moon Pose. “This posture is nice for stability, focus, and core energy,” says Aidala. “All of that are wanted to carry onto the soccer.” He additionally suggests Crow Pose, which is sorta like being on the receiving finish of a penalty kick—it occurs fairly sometimes however could make all of the distinction. Aidala cites the sturdy higher physique, palms, and grip that consequence from holding the physique aloft within the arm stability as important in not fumbling the ball.

Bonus (penalty) factors for any participant who can summon the core energy and physique consciousness required to handle the transition from Half Moon Pose into Crow Pose, whether or not swish or in any other case.

Each Chiefs and Eagles: Psychological Resilience

After which there’s the psychological tenacity required to maintain your composure as you vie for one of the vital coveted sports activities titles on the earth. The night is lengthy, feelings are excessive, and the pageantry could be greater than a bit distracting.

“With the ability to keep in and keep dedicated even when it’s troublesome is a follow of resiliency,” says Aidala. “Each groups are going to want this.” Resiliency contains having the ability to bend with out breaking, to face up to the immense build-up, and to navigate the dramatic twists and turns with some measure of equanimity. That applies to coaches in addition to gamers.

“A yoga asana (bodily) follow can convey up a whole lot of private edges, together with areas inside your thoughts the place you need to give up, both since you’re distracted or as a result of the pose is difficult and also you need to transfer onto the subsequent one,” explains Aidala.
